Online Exposure - Your home, if listed by a Realtor, will be automatically displayed on the Houston Association of Realtor's web site at www.Har.Com, national real estate web sites such as www.Realtor.Com, www.Homeseekers.Com, www.Homes.Com, www.HomeAdvisor.Com, Yahoo Classifieds, The Houston Chronicle, and individual Agent, Broker, and Franchise web sites.. Agents in the IREC Network enhance your listing at these online locations by adding digital photography, slideshows, and virtual tours to your property pages. Statistics show that without one of these, your property has at least 75% less chance of being seen than those that do. IREC additionally provides these enhancements throughout its network to many other Realtor and local web sites.

Depending upon the specific real estate web site, any mix of the enhancements may appear with your listing. IREC provides a utility for Sellers to monitor the display of their property on many of these web sites at www.IREC.com.

Print Media Exposure - Any digital photography and/or virtual tours produced by IREC result in 4-6 weekend days of ads published in The Houston Chronicle real estate classified section of the newspaper. The ads will have 4 lines of listing and agent content and be "ear marked" with a virtual tour icon to grab the reader's attention. A unique URL or MLS number will be at the bottom of each ad directing the shopper to view the property online at The Chronicle virtual tour gallery at www.chroniclehomes.com. The number of ads run will be based on the ordered product, but will usually run 2-3 consecutive weekends. At a value of up to $294.60, these ads substantially contribute to online viewing and offline inquiries about your home. Please be patient - To properly manage your listing over the Internet several steps are involved before the distribution to all the pertinent websites begins. After a photographer visits your property, it may take a day or two before pictures and/or virtual tours begin appearing on the Internet. Your Agent must have time to properly select any pictures to be printed and which ones should be included on individual websites. The digital media will appear first at www.IREC.com and other sites begin to follow during the next several days.
